FATIMA; A data acquisition system for medium scale experiments

This paper discusses the data acquisition system FATIMA (Fera Amplitude and Time Multiparameter Analyzer) utilizing CAMAC, FERA and a VAX-Station, designed and built for nuclear physics experiments like subthreshold {pi}{sup 0}-production in Heavy Ion Collisions. The major features of the system are fast data readout of up to 352 ADCs and/or TDCs in conjunction with data reduction, event buffering, high speed data transfer and simple interfacing to any workstation. For on-line acquisition, recording and analysis of data as well as experiment control a modular program system was developed on VAX/VMS. Data analysis comprises on-line sort of real and pseudo channels and graphical representation of sorted data.
